Franklin, MA -- April 11 -- The tense courtroom drama "Twelve Angry Jurors" will conclude the 2010-2011 Dean College theatre season. The production, which opens on April 13, will be presented in the College's black box studio space located in the Performing Arts Studio on School Street in Franklin.
Twelve Angry Jurors is a stage adaptation of Reginald Rose’s 1954 teleplay, 12 Angry Men and depicts a jury forced to reconsider its nearly unanimous verdict by a single hold out who manages to sow a seed of reasonable doubt. The play begins after closing arguments have been completed in a homicide case, as a judge is giving final instructions to the jury. The play examines the various conflicts arising between 12 people charged with delivering justice in a case where personal prejudice and varied life experiences color their judgment. The play is being directed by Michael LoCicero, a Dean College alum who has been pursuing a career in film and stage since graduating from Dean.
The play is being produced as a process piece where production values such as set and costumes have been deemphasized in favor of highlighting the script and the actors. “It’s a way to give the students an opportunity to sink their teeth into a meaty play that fits smoothly into are production schedule”, said Jim Beauregard Dean College’s technical director. “We take pride in our high production values here but theater can be just as powerful when done simply,” Beauregard continued. “Great theatre only requires three things, a script, some actors and an audience.”
